The July unrest taught SA it needs an 'agile' army, defence and military veterans minister Thandi Modise told the SA Human Rights Commission on Friday.

Defence minister Thandi Modise said SA needed a well equipped, well capacitated and agile military. File picture.The July unrest taught SA it needs an “agile” army, defence and military veterans minister Thandi Modise told the SA Human Rights Commission on Friday.

“It has taught us we need an agile defence force, that even though we do not want the defence force to be deployed internally, we must be on hand. We must have the required transportation. We must have tools of the trade for members deployed,” she said. “Looking at what was happening, would it have been wrong for South Africans to stand up to say [that] the police and military, who are defending our liberty, are in need of water and transport? I would say the situation demanded that all right-thinking South Africans would jump in.
